It is difficult to determine the exact number of ideal CAT mocks one should write as it greatly depends on the individual’s subjective needs. It is comparable to asking how much one should eat to remain healthy and strong – there is no standard answer. However, in this article, we will attempt to provide a specific number.
More than the quantity of mocks, the improvement shown in consecutive Ideal Number CAT mocks is what truly matters. Writing 30 mocks without any progress is not as valuable as someone who only writes three mocks and sees a significant increase in their percentile from 60 to 90. It is the learning gained from these mocks that truly counts, not the quantity alone.
Our education system requires individuals to work extremely hard to excel, but this is not necessarily the case for aptitude exams like CAT. To succeed in CAT, one must strike a balance between hard work and quality work.
While there is no upper limit to the number of mocks one should write, we recommend aspiring CAT students to write a minimum of 15 mocks. Some individuals may perform well from the very first mock, while others may require writing 5 mocks to gain a better understanding of their strategy.
Instead of focusing solely on the number of mocks, attention should be given to three important aspects:
What should you do before you start writing the CAT mocks?
Prior preparation is crucial before attempting mocks. It is not advisable to write mocks without adequate preparation as it may lead to incorrect self-assessment. This can result in demotivation or complacency based on unexpected performance. Before writing CAT mocks, ensure you have completed at least 7 to 8 sectional tests and have balanced speed and accuracy.
What should you do while writing the CAT mocks?
While writing mocks, always prioritize questions that are familiar and seem easy and doable. Do not worry about difficult questions as they do not determine your percentile. Instead, focus on quickly identifying and accurately solving the easy and moderately difficult questions. By solving easy questions with high accuracy, one can achieve 80-90 percentile. Adding moderately difficult questions can lead to scoring 95 percentile in all three sections.
What should you do after writing a CAT mock?
Post-mock analysis is often overlooked but is crucial to your preparation. The analysis will determine your readiness for the next stage of the selection process. Your hard work and performance in mocks indicate your potential success in the actual exam. Properly analyze your performance after each mock and identify areas of improvement. Personal analysis is more effective in learning from mistakes compared to relying on others for feedback.
The post-mock analysis is a valuable learning opportunity and should not be postponed out of fear. Embrace this process to enhance your preparation for CAT.
